As the golden rays of summer envelop us in warmth, it’s the perfect time to talk about the sunshine vitamin, also known as Vitamin D. This essential nutrient, produced when our skin is exposed to sunlight, plays a crucial role in maintaining our overall health. Let’s dive into the many reasons why you should soak in some rays this summer and how it can positively impact your well-being.
Feeling a bit blue? You might be missing out on your daily dose of Vitamin D. This incredible vitamin is known for its mood-boosting properties. When our skin absorbs sunlight, it helps our body produce Vitamin D, which in turn, can help improve our mood and ward off feelings of depression. This is because Vitamin D is involved in the production of serotonin, a neurotransmitter that regulates mood. So, the next time you’re feeling down, step outside and let the sun work its magic. Even just 10-30 minutes of midday sunlight can make a significant difference in how you feel.
Our bones are the framework of our body, and keeping them strong is essential for overall health. Vitamin D plays a crucial role in calcium absorption, which is vital for maintaining strong bones and teeth. Without adequate Vitamin D, our bodies struggle to absorb calcium, leading to weakened bones and an increased risk of fractures. By ensuring you get enough sunlight and including Vitamin D-rich foods in your diet, you can help maintain strong and healthy bones. Foods like fatty fish (such as salmon), egg yolks, and fortified foods are excellent sources of this vital nutrient.
A robust immune system is your body’s best defense against illnesses, and Vitamin D plays a key role in supporting it. Studies have shown that Vitamin D can enhance the pathogen-fighting effects of monocytes and macrophages, two important types of white blood cells that play a crucial role in immune defense. By boosting your Vitamin D levels, you can help your body fight off infections and stay healthy. So, make it a habit to spend some time outdoors every day and let the sun help you stay strong and resilient.
While sunlight is the most natural and effective way to boost your Vitamin D levels, it’s not the only source. Here are some additional ways to ensure you’re getting enough of this essential nutrient:
Sunlight: Just 10-30 minutes of midday sunlight can significantly boost your Vitamin D levels. Aim to spend some time outside every day, especially during the summer months when the sun is strongest.
Foods: Include fatty fish like salmon, egg yolks, and fortified foods (such as milk, orange juice, and cereals) in your diet. These foods are rich in Vitamin D and can help you maintain adequate levels.
Supplements: If you’re unable to get enough sunlight or have difficulty including Vitamin D-rich foods in your diet, consider taking a Vitamin D supplement. Consult with your healthcare provider to determine the right dosage for you.
While it’s important to soak in some sun, it’s equally important to do so safely. Here are a few tips to help you enjoy the summer sun without putting your skin at risk:
Use Sunscreen: Ap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of at least 30 to protect your skin from harmful UV rays. Reapply every two hours, or more often if you’re swimming or sweating.
Seek Shade: Avoid direct sunlight during peak hours (10 am to 4 pm) when the sun’s rays are the strongest. Seek shade under trees, umbrellas, or wear protective clothing and hats.
Stay Hydrated: Drinking plenty of water is essential to stay hydrated, especially when spending time in the sun. Dehydration can exacerbate the effects of sun exposure, so keep a water bottle handy and drink regularly.
By following these tips, you can enjoy the benefits of Vitamin D without compromising your skin’s health.
